What you will doProvide leadership and direction to clinical site management team members from study start through to closureServe as Site Management’s primary point of contact and representative for clinical monitoring and site activities within the project, including, but not limited toPrimary Sponsor ContactManage monitoring deliverables to achieve the study budget and identify out-of-scope activitiesWhat you will bring to the roleExcellent interpersonal, oral, and written communication skills in EnglishAbility to lead and motivate a team remotelyDemonstrate initiative and problem-solving skills by offering solutions when obstacles are identifiedStrong customer focus, ability to interact professionally with a sponsor contactProficiency in Microsoft Office, CTMS, and EDC SystemsYour experienceBachelor’s Degree or a Nursing Degree required2+ years’ experience as a Clinical Trial Manager, Clinical Operations Leader, Lead CRA, or equivalent role3+ years’ experience as a Clinical Research AssociateOncology experience is requiredWillingness to travel up to 30%At Worldwide Clinical Trials, we are committed to fostering an inclusive and equitable workplace by providing transparent compensation. The salary range for this position is annually (For hourly paid positions, the stated salary range reflects hourly rates): United States of America - $112,000.00 - $222,000.00The salary range provided is intended to give candidates an understanding of potential earnings. Compensation will fall within the provided range, and it not a guarantee of exact salary. The final salary will be determined based on relevant experience, performance, education, and internal equity. In addition to base salary, we offer a competitive benefits package depending on location. We ensure pay equity and transparency and comply with all applicable labor laws.
